TURN-208: Gatevale turnstile counters at the Merrow Field pilot double-count when a rotation reverses mid-cycle. Attendance totals drift roughly 2% high per event. The debounce window fix is implemented, reviewed by Ilsa, and soak-tested across two simulated match days without drift. Ready for your cut; the candidate build is identified below.

trace token, tagag-tafog: htk6_5ed18c

Ticket: Staging env misconfigured for Siftgate bloom filter

The bloom layer in front of the Pellet KV store is rejecting all lookups in staging because the env file was copied from the dev template without credentials. False-positive tuning values are fine; only the auth line is missing. To unblock the weekly demo, the Pellet admission secret must be set on the following line.

env line for yaguf-fajop: LEDGER_TOKEN13=fb08984397349

Handover: report builder sort stability

For whoever picks up Tallygrove next: the report builder's sort was not stable before v2.4, so rows with equal keys could reorder between runs. We now pin a tiebreaker on row insertion order. Snapshot tests depend on this, so don't swap the comparator casually. The sorter reads its behavior flags from the following configuration.

config for tajof-yaguf:
[istox]
team = aldius
access_code = ac_29be1b
owner = holok.praix
host = istox.zarqelsoft.test
port = 11211
peer = novath.olvarqio.example
salt = 983a9dc6
pin = 4652

### Step 3: Enable the Cravenholt breaker

For this week's sync: step 3 of the Marlowe migration turns on the circuit breaker in front of the Cravenholt upstream API. The old retry-forever client is removed; calls now flow through the breaker middleware, which opens after repeated failures and probes with half-open requests before closing. Teams should update dashboards to track breaker state rather than raw retry counts, since retry metrics disappear after this step. Apply the migration with the settings shown below.

deployment values, bahof-badug:
[rusix]
team = zorok
access_code = ac_641cbe
owner = ulair.tamius
host = rusix.torvasoft.local
port = 5672
peer = ulaix.sivrelworks.internal
salt = 1df570ed
pin = 6327